Striking Non-academic Staff Unions Threaten To Disrupt 2018 Utme by Newsbreakers: 8:09am On Mar 09, 2018
The striking Non-Teaching Staff of the Nigerian Universities has threatened to disrupt the 2018 Unified Tertiary Matriculation Examination (UTME) set to hold from March 9.

Mr Samson Ugwoke, Chairman, Joint Action Committee (JAC), Non-Teaching Staff of the Nigerian Universities, made the threat at a meeting of the National JAC with the Principal Branch Officers on Wednesday in Abuja.
